Repository: cassandra
Updated Branches:
  refs/heads/cassandra-3.0 363e7bd71 -> ed96322a0
  refs/heads/trunk abf7df3bd -> 37986e825


Fix sstableloader not working with upper case keyspace name

patch by Alex Liu; reviewed by yukim for CASSANDRA-10806


Project: http://git-wip-us.apache.org/repos/asf/cassandra/repo
Commit: http://git-wip-us.apache.org/repos/asf/cassandra/commit/ed96322a
Tree: http://git-wip-us.apache.org/repos/asf/cassandra/tree/ed96322a
Diff: http://git-wip-us.apache.org/repos/asf/cassandra/diff/ed96322a

Branch: refs/heads/cassandra-3.0
Commit: ed96322a0dfc106e2270a7d0b9930a5311eadcbf
Parents: 363e7bd
Author: Alex Liu <[email protected]>
Authored: Wed Dec 16 14:34:24 2015 -0600
Committer: Yuki Morishita <[email protected]>
Committed: Wed Dec 16 14:34:24 2015 -0600

----------------------------------------------------------------------
 CHANGES.txt                                                        | 1 +
 src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java | 2 +-
 2 files changed, 2 insertions(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/cassandra/blob/ed96322a/CHANGES.txt
----------------------------------------------------------------------
diff --git a/CHANGES.txt b/CHANGES.txt
index 10504c7..7677e38 100644
--- a/CHANGES.txt
+++ b/CHANGES.txt
@@ -1,4 +1,5 @@
 3.0.3
+ * Fix sstableloader not working with upper case keyspace name 
(CASSANDRA-10806)
 Merged from 2.2:
  * Add new types to Stress (CASSANDRA-9556)
  * Add property to allow listening on broadcast interface (CASSANDRA-9748)

http://git-wip-us.apache.org/repos/asf/cassandra/blob/ed96322a/src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java
----------------------------------------------------------------------
diff --git a/src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java 
b/src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java
index 840ef26..bb927fc 100644
--- a/src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java
+++ b/src/java/org/apache/cassandra/utils/NativeSSTableLoaderClient.java
@@ -75,7 +75,7 @@ public class NativeSSTableLoaderClient extends 
SSTableLoader.Client
 
             for (TokenRange tokenRange : tokenRanges)
             {
-                Set<Host> endpoints = metadata.getReplicas(keyspace, 
tokenRange);
+                Set<Host> endpoints = 
metadata.getReplicas(Metadata.quote(keyspace), tokenRange);
                 Range<Token> range = new 
Range<>(tokenFactory.fromString(tokenRange.getStart().getValue().toString()),
                                                  
tokenFactory.fromString(tokenRange.getEnd().getValue().toString()));
                 for (Host endpoint : endpoints)

Reply via email to